  • Patent number: 10649692
    Abstract: A method of operating a storage device includes receiving a write task from a host device. The method also includes storing the write task in a task queue included in the storage device. A write execution command is received from the host device. The method includes executing the write task in response to the write execution command and performing an internal management operation of the storage device after the write task is stored in the task queue and before the write execution command is received. The response time of the storage device to the write execution command is reduced and performance of the system is enhanced by performing the internal management operation such as the data backup operation during the queuing stage and the ready stage in advance before receiving the write execution command.

  • Patent number: 10613975
    Abstract: A memory device and a dynamic garbage collection method thereof are provided. The method includes receiving a minimum operating speed, ascertaining a reference valid page count ratio (VPC), using a maximum operating speed, the minimum operating speed, and a garbage collection speed, the reference VPC ratio being ascertained by the following formula 1 and determining whether to perform a garbage collection, using the reference VPC ratio and a current average VPC ratio. <Formula 1> Vr=Gp (Jp?Mp)/(Jp*Mp+(Gp*(Jp?Mp))) Here, Vr is the reference VPC ratio, Gp is the garbage collection speed, Jp is the maximum operating speed, and Mp is the minimum operating speed.

  • Patent number: 10323529
    Abstract: A turbine includes a rotor shaft having a plurality of rotating blades mounted on the rotor shaft, a bearing assembly rotatably supporting the rotor shaft, a casing forming a passage of a fluid and to include a space in which the rotating blades are disposed so that thermal energy of the fluid is converted into mechanical energy by rotation, a foundation fixedly supporting the bearing assembly, and a packing device installed in the rotor shaft for sealing between the casing and the rotor shaft and supported by the foundation. The casing comprises a connection unit extended toward the packing device and fixed to the casing so that a location of the connection unit is relatively changed with respect to the packing device. Accordingly, there is an advantage in that the leakage of a fluid is reduced because a clearance between the packing device and the rotor shaft is reduced.

  • Patent number: 10060297
    Abstract: Disclosed herein is an apparatus for reactor power control of a steam turbine power generation system including a reactor, a high-pressure turbine to which steam is supplied from the reactor through a main steam pipe, a low-pressure turbine to which the steam discharged from the high-pressure turbine is supplied via a moisture separator reheater, a branch pipe branched from the main steam pipe to be connected to the moisture separator reheater, a generator connected to the low-pressure turbine, a condenser for condensing the steam discharged from the low-pressure turbine, a condensate pump for feeding condensate condensed by the condenser, and feed water heaters for heating the condensate, the apparatus including a branch pipe control valve provided on the branch pipe and a control unit for controlling an opening degree of the branch pipe control valve.
